Restoration progress is continuing at a historic theatre in downtown Sioux Falls.
Officials with the State Theatre will give an update to the public on Oct. 4 at 3 p.m. in the lobby located at 316 S. Phillips Ave.
In addition, the public is invited to drop by the theatre between 5 p.m. and 9 p.m. on Oct. 5 to check out the recent progress in the auditorium during a First Friday Art & Wine Walk.
The infrastructure of the aging building has been rebuilt to preserve the structure, and features such as the lobby have been restored. Officials said an additional $5.5 million is needed to complete work on the auditorium and upper levels of the building.

The State Theatre was built in 1926 and remains a downtown landmark.
